Readability and Production Advice

As a maker, you need to consider how your design translates from screen to physical product. For King Oyen, its inherent cleanliness is a major asset.

When printing on cards or labels, ensure you use a sufficient font size for longer phrases to maintain its elegant flow. For cutting machine projects, always do a test cut or print preview, especially with intricate scripts. King Oyen’s balanced strokes generally translate well, but previewing helps catch any potential issues with very thin connectors on specific letters.

This font excels as a display font—use it for headlines, product names, and key phrases where you want impact and charm. For accompanying text like ingredient lists, addresses, or detailed descriptions, pair it with a clean sans serif font or a simple serif font. This combination, such as King Oyen for the brand name and a neutral sans serif for the details, creates hierarchy, enhances overall readability, and looks professionally cohesive.

Font Features and Commercial Considerations

When selecting a font for commercial work, digging into its features is a practical necessity. Based on its description as a modern handwritten font, King Oyen likely offers a consistent set of glyphs designed for a natural flow. Look for features like alternates or ligatures that can add subtle variation, allowing you to customize words for a more authentic handwritten look. Check its included file formats to ensure compatibility with your software, whether that’s Adobe Illustrator for SVG creation, Canva for social media graphics, or your preferred printing software.

Most critically, always verify the commercial font license. You need a license that explicitly permits using the font for selling physical products (like mugs and signs), digital downloads (printables, templates, SVG files), and client work (such as designing invitations for a customer). A proper commercial license protects your business and is a standard, responsible practice for every serious crafter and shop owner.
